README

This is a lightweight and easy-to-use Laravel package that allows you to manage user roles and permissions in your application with minimal effort. With this package, you can use lots of pre-defined methods for implementing roles and permissions, as well as assign roles to users and check their permissions. This package provides a simple and intuitive way of coding that makes it easy to integrate with your existing application. It also comes with built-in middleware that you can use to protect routes based on user roles and permissions. Whether you're building a small application or a large-scale system, "Simple Role Permission" provides a flexible and scalable solution for managing user roles and permissions. It's perfect for developers who want a simple and lightweight package that gets the job done without any unnecessary complexity.

Installation

Use the package manager composer to install this package.

composer require raisulhridoy/simplerolepermission

Add the service provider in config/app.php file in the providers array as below:

RaisulHridoy\SimpleRolePermission\SRPServiceProvider::class,

Publish the package configuration

php artisan vendor:publish --provider="RaisulHridoy\SimpleRolePermission\SRPServiceProvider"

Specify table name corresponding to the role and permission functionality in ".env" file. By default, it will be 'users' respectively and "role_id" column will be added in this table.

ROLE_WITH_TABLE=

For example, if you want to use "admins" table for the role functionality, then you have to specify like this in ".env" file.

ROLE_WITH_TABLE=admins

Run these commands to clear the cache and migrate the database.

php artisan config:clear
php artisan cache:clear
php artisan migrate

Basic Usage

# Initialize the namespace
use RaisulHridoy\SimpleRolePermission\Http\App\SRP;

Create a new role

# Create a new role with name 'admin'
SRP::createRole('Admin');

# Can also be catch response as
$response = SRP::createRole('Admin');

# Response will be like
$response = [
    'status' => 'success',
    'message' => 'Role created successfully',
    'data' => [
        'id' => 1, // this is the role-ID will be the primary-key
        'name' => 'Admin',
        'slug' => 'admin',
        'identifier' => 569832,
    ]
];

Remove a role

# Remove an existing role with role-ID like example below
SRP::deleteRole(1);

# Can also catch response as
$response = SRP::deleteRole(1);

Update a role

# update role by adding params role-ID & role-name like example below
SRP::updateRole(1,'Admin');

# Can also catch response as
$response = SRP::updateRole(1,'Admin');

View all roles

# Get all roles from database without paginate
$response = SRP::allRoles();

# Get all roles with paginate by adding params
$response = SRP::allRoles(10);

View all permissions

# Get all permissions from database without paginate
$response = SRP::allPermissions();

# Get all permissions with paginate by adding params
$response = SRP::allPermissions(10);

Sync Permission for Role

# Update permissions for a specific role by role-ID & array of permission-ID as params
SRP::syncPermission(1, [2,3,4]);

Assigned Permissions for User

# Get assigned permissions details collection by role-ID in param
$response = SRP::assignedPermissions(1);

# Get assigned permissions details collection as group by role-ID in param
$response = SRP::assignedPermissionsGroup(1);

# Get assigned permissions-ID as array by role-ID in param
$response = SRP::assignedPermissionIDs(1);

Create New Permission

# Create new permission by adding permission-name in param like below
SRP::createPermission('Permission Name');

# Create new permission with group by adding extra param like below
SRP::createPermission('Permission Name','Permission Group');

Update Permission

# Update permission by adding permission-ID, permission-name in param like below
SRP::updatePermission(1,'Permission Name');

# Create new permission with group by adding extra param like below
SRP::updatePermission(1,'Permission Name','Permission Group');

Remove Permission

# Remove a permission by adding permission-ID in param like below
SRP::deletePermission(1);

Check User Accessibility

# Checking accessibility with permission-name & role-ID
SRP::checkPermissionByName('Permission Name',1);

# Checking accessibility with permission-ID & role-ID
SRP::checkPermissionByID(2,1);

Check User Accessibility in Blade

# Checking accessibility with blade directive with param role name or role slug & permission name or permission group like below
@cando('Admin','Dashboard')
@endcando
